Position Purpose:
This position provides hands on HR generalist/administrative support to the Western Canada District providing a high degree of confidentiality and professionalism. Ensures accuracy in transactional activities and has the ability to manage multiple requests while maintaining strong customer service. The position will be based in Lethbridge, AB Canada.
Principal Accountabilities:
20% Employee Relations: Provide support, coaching and resources for managers/employees. Monitor workplace for issues. Provide leadership in handling of issues related to policy and procedures, employment law, benefits, worker's compensation, open enrollment, employee discipline/termination, and employment related investigations.
25% Processing and data entry of HR transactions. This includes new hire/transfer/termination paperwork, employee changes (compensation, promotions, title, manager, etc.), leaves of absence, etc.
20% Employee Selection/Retention: Provide leadership to selection/retention activities handled at the locations. Work closely with Talent Recruiting for corporately recruited positions. Ensure compliance to recruitment guidelines and management understanding of the selection process. Conduct new hire on boarding. Complete exit interviews and ensure appropriate follow-up.
25% Business Unit Specific HR Initiatives: Ensure compliance and upkeep of all HR process related requirements. Conduct audits where appropriate. Serve as lead or support for various initiatives at the locations or within BU on execution of HR Business Plan including areas such as engagement, guiding principles, HR process optimization, Performance Management Plan, career development, employment equity and training.
10% Contact for HR queries regarding benefits, policies, and processes. Maintain the Western Canada HR SharePoint site
